What You Should And Shouldn’t Do When Dealing With Water Damage
Water offers life, yet water breach on some components where it's not supposed to be can result in damage and inconvenience. In addition, residences with water damages scent old and also stuffy.

Water can come from lots of resources like tropical cyclones, floods, burst pipes, leakages, and also drain problems. It's much better to have a functioning expertise of safety preventative measures if you have water damage. Right here are a few standards on how to take care of water damages.

 

 

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Policy Coverage



Seasonal water damages can originate from floodings, seasonal rains, as well as wind. There is likewise an incident of an unexpected flood, whether it came from a defective pipe that suddenly breaks right into your residence. To secure your house, get home insurance coverage that covers both acts of God such as all-natural tragedies, as well as emergencies like damaged plumbing.

 

 

Don't Fail To Remember to Turn Off Energies



When disaster strikes and also you remain in a flood-prone location, switch off the main electric circuit. Turning off the power protects against
When water comes in as water offers as a conductor, electrical shocks. Don't forget to switch off the primary water line valve as a means to avoid more damages.
Maintain your furnishings steady as they can relocate about and trigger added damage if the floodwaters are getting high.

 

 

Do Remain Proactive and also Heed Weather Informs



Tornado floods can be extremely uncertain. Stay positive and also ready at all times if you live in a location tormented by floodings. If you live near a body of water like a river, creek, or lake , pay attention to the news and evacuation warnings. Get your belongings and also important documents from the ground floor and basement, then put them in a safe place and the highest possible degree.

 

 

Do Not Disregard the Roof



Your roofer should take treatment of the defective seamless gutters or any other signs of damage or weakening. An evaluation will protect against water from flowing down your walls as well as saturating your ceiling.

 

 

Do Take Note Of Small Leakages



A ruptured pipe does not take place in a vacuum or overnight. There are red flags that can attract your attention as well as suggest to you some weakened pipes in your house. Indications of red flags in your pipelines consist of bubbling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water touches, water spots, or leaking audios behind the walls. There are signs that the pipe will certainly burst. If you see these indicators, do not wait for an acceleration. Repair service and evaluate your plumbing repaired before it leads to substantial damages to your home, funds, and an individual problem.

 

 

Do Not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ipe



Timing is vital when it comes to water damages. If a pipe bursts in your residence, quickly closed off your primary water valve to cut off the source and protect against more damage. Call a trusted water damages reconstruction professional for help.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ts

 

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.



 

DO these things to improve your situation

 

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.

 

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.

 

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.


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.

 

DON’T do any of these things for any reason

 

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.


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.


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.


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
